Howto Pin Objects
Question:
Can I pin an object so that it is not affected by other design changes? Answer: Once you have created the look of your project, you may want to 'lock' the objects to the page, but still be able to change their properties and edit their actions. This is known as 'pinning' an object to the page. To Pin an object: 1) Select the desired object. 2) Right-click on the object. 3) Choose Pin. To Unpin an object: 1) Select the desired object. 2) Right-click on the object. 3) Choose Pin. |
